How to Stay Hydrated During Outdoor Adventure Fitness Sessions
Staying hydrated is crucial during outdoor adventure fitness sessions, especially when participating in rigorous activities. Water is essential for maintaining optimal body function, regulating temperature, and ensuring peak performance. Inadequate hydration can lead to fatigue, decreased endurance, and serious health risks. It’s vital to drink plenty of fluids before, during, and after your fitness activities. Begin by assessing your hydration needs based on the intensity and duration of your activity. For longer sessions, consider the use of electrolyte drinks to replenish lost minerals, such as sodium and potassium. Know the signs of dehydration, which include dry mouth, fatigue, dizziness, and dark urine. Additionally, try to drink before you feel thirsty, as this is a key indicator that your body might already be dehydrated. Carrying a water bottle or hydration pack can help ensure you have access to fluids throughout your adventure. Balancing hydration with your nutrition is also beneficial, so incorporate water-rich foods like fruits and vegetables into your pre-activity meals. Pay attention to your body and adjust your fluid intake accordingly for the best results.

Understanding the Importance of Electrolytes
Electrolytes are vital for maintaining fluid balance within the body, playing an essential role in hydration during outdoor adventure fitness activities. Common electrolytes include sodium, potassium, calcium, and magnesium, which can be lost through sweat during vigorous exercise. When engaging in prolonged physical activities, particularly in high heat, replenishing these electrolytes is necessary to prevent fatigue, muscle cramps, and overall health complications. Drink beverages containing electrolytes at regular intervals, especially when sweating heavily, to support optimal cellular functions. Many athletes prefer sports drinks rich in electrolytes due to their convenience and accessibility. However, be conscious of sugar content in these drinks, as consuming too much sugar can have opposite effects on hydration. Evaluating your individual needs and adjusting your electrolyte intake accordingly can provide tailored hydration strategies that suit your adventure. Consider also blending natural electrolyte-infused recipes using coconut water, fruits, or homemade sports drinks featuring essential minerals. With proper attention to electrolytes, fluid consumption will result in enhanced performance and overall wellbeing, further emphasizing the importance of hydration in adventure fitness.

Post-Adventure Recovery: Hydration Considerations
After completing an outdoor adventure fitness session, it’s essential to rehydrate effectively to recover speedily and efficiently. Failing to hydrate post-activity can slow recovery, leading to fatigue or muscle cramping. Start the recovery process by drinking fluids immediately following your activity—water should be your top priority. Gauge your hydration status by weighing yourself before and after your exercise; for every pound lost, drink about 16-24 ounces of fluids. This practice is especially relevant in hot climates where sweat loss can be significant. Provide your body with additional nutrients by consuming hydrating foods, focusing on fruits and vegetables that have high-water content and essential vitamins. Hydration powders or recovery drinks may also be beneficial to replace lost electrolytes post-exercise.
